By Stephanie Ford In March 2022, British Columbia's Ministry of Municipal Affairs announced changes to the BC Provincial Nominee Program (BC PNP) Skills Immigration Stream. These changes are in response to the critical need or more healthcare workers and early childhood educators (ECE) in the province. Here's what you need to know about these changes to the BCPNP. Overview of the BC PNP Program Under the BC PNP, applicants who currently live in the province may be invited to apply for the provincial nominee program based on their individual attributes. Essentially, applicants are invited based on what skills and experience they can bring…

BC Tech Pilot to become a permanent stream of the BC Provincial Nominee Program
British Columbia has announced that the BC Tech Pilot has been extended indefinitely and renamed BC PNP Tech. The province wants to provide B.C. tech employers with the continued ability to recruit and retain international talent when local skilled workers are unavailable. BC PNP Tech offers people in 29 tech occupations a prioritized pathway to permanent residency: NOC Job Title 0131 Telecommunication carriers managers 0213 Computer and information systems managers 0512 Managers - publishing, motion pictures, broadcasting and performing arts 2131 Civil engineers 2132 Mechanical engineers 2133 Electrical and electronics engineers 2134 Chemical engineers 2147 Computer engineers (except software engineers and designers) 2171 Information systems analysts and consultants 2172 Database analysts and data…
